Gray Short-tailed Bat vs Patchwork cuttlefish
Carollia subrufa compared with Sepia vermiculata
Key Differences
- Gray Short-tailed Bat is Least Concern while Patchwork cuttlefish is Data Deficient.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gray Short-tailed Bat | Patchwork cuttlefish |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(प्राणी) | Animalia (प्राणी) |
| Phylum | Chordata (रज्जुकी) | Mollusca (मोलस्का) |
| Class | Mammalia (स्तनधारी) | Cephalopoda (शीर्षपाद) |
| Order | Chiroptera (चमगादड़) | Sepiida (समुद्रफेनी)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Sepiidae |
| Genus | Carollia | Sepia |
| Species | Carollia subrufa | Sepia vermiculata |
Evolutionary Relationship
Gray Short-tailed Bat and Patchwork cuttlefish share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(प्राणी)
